Our leathers are an assortment of the finest hides sourced from the markets of Europe.
Categorized into A+, A, B+, B, C+, C and C-, the top selection of A+ and A are used for making wet white and top grain Ardine leathers (used by the R.R. Bentlys, LVMHs, Bassys, Mahbachs and Poltrores etc.) Our top line Melo Boltique, Nordic and Swedish collection of leather belongs to this category.
The B+, B and C+ grades are used for semi Ardine upholstery (widely popular among cars like Mercedes Benz, BMW and Audi). Our Satin, Montona, Tuscana and Scandinavia leathers are from these selections.
The C+ and C grade are used for corrected grain articles which are usually the entry level leathers used by almost 90% of European car and furniture manufacturers. Our satin and classic collections belong to this selection.
